  My roommates surgery in Montreal was $16,000 US last May.  No grafting or anything special....just general aenesthesia and a litttle nip/tuck.  Dr. Brassards rates have stayed fairly reasonable over the years....I think Dr. Marci Bowers in Trinidad, Colorado is about the same price.  I'll pay an extra couple thousand if I have to just to have him do mine.  His work is spectacular and as mentioned before.....He's REALLY cute. 

  My roommate had her SRS on her actual birthday last year.  Right before they wheeled the bed into the OR he stopped and sang her "Happy Birthday".   If there was ever a question in my mind that I might choose another surgeon it ended then.   The man truly cares about his patients and is so humble in the process you can't not love him.
